الملخص EN

The control accurately of internal pressure, axial feeding and paths of loading which have important influences on the final tube quality.

In this research an impact of loading path of the tube hydroforming process and final part requirements ( i.e.

thickness specification and shape conformation) were studied numerically.

Small bulge shape tube hydroforming parts were utilized in the finite element analyses to get several guidelines on the effect of the relation between the internal pressure and axial compressive feeding programs.

Two dimension model of bulge shape tube (50 mm) bulge width has been developed from cylindrical tube with thickness (2mm) of the copper and (60 mm) outer diameter.

A commercial available finite element program code (ANSYS 11), is used to perform the numerical simulation of the tube hydroforming operation.

The results demonstrate that, the loading path has very important influenced on the thickness distribution over the tube and capability attained the target shape of the required product
